Transaction 754acca13cf9bbfbb3aa72680435aafdf005fb75904f233e2bfaf5e67f6421be
1 Input
1 Output
-
754acca13cf9bbfbb3aa72680435aafdf005fb75904f233e2bfaf5e67f6421be:0
- value
- 886000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7e163a467fb4e0b9e6d3b8626e2e3662a84514c OP_EQUAL
- address
- 3QHgqF6qP7eyMBQZnzv6tnFRo1HBDPDua6